Output 561a2f12df4bf31a17449637d0cb242452f701135c8fc7ca7e30d8b9abba63dd:3

value
27880000
script pubkey
OP_0 OP_PUSHBYTES_20 bf5755028eedf5bd45e2882c3a5c6c18eac341ae
address
ltc1qhat42q5wah6m630z3qkr5hrvrr4vxsdwpakan9
transaction
561a2f12df4bf31a17449637d0cb242452f701135c8fc7ca7e30d8b9abba63dd
spent
true